Spezifikationen
| Attribut | Wert |
| Part Status | Active |
| Technology | Standard |
| Voltage - DC Reverse (Vr) (Max) | 600 V |
| Current - Average Rectified (Io) | 1A |
| Voltage - Forward (Vf) (Max) @ If | 1.1 V @ 1 A |
| Speed | Standard Recovery >500ns, > 200mA (Io) |
| Current - Reverse Leakage @ Vr | 10 µA @ 600 V |
| Mounting Type | Surface Mount |
| Package / Case | DO-214AC, SMA |
| Supplier Device Package | SMA |
| Operating Temperature - Junction | -55°C ~ 150°C |
| Base Product Number | MRA4005 |
